About this listen

It's well known that if we want to keep our bodies fit, we must go for a run from time to time. But why do so few of us take the time to develop our mental fitness, too?

Enter The Mind Workout: a home exercise programme for improving your mental health and fitness.

Developed from Mark Freeman's own recovery from several mental illnesses, The Mind Workout combines mindfulness, cognitive behavioural therapy (CBT) and acceptance and commitment therapy (ACT) to outline a groundbreaking health-first approach to strengthening mental and emotional well-being. The Mind Workout will leave you feeling stronger, fitter and better equipped to make healthy changes while navigating the complexities of everyday life.
